The Victorian Hardcover; a Hands on Introduction to Bookbinding

Bring home your own piece of the past at Ross Bay Villa Historic House Museum. Joan Byers is an instructor and member of the Canadian Bookbinders and Book Artists Guild. She will discuss the basics of traditional bookbinding and will assist participants in creating a small, sewn, multi-signature, cloth covered book with methods commonly employed during the Victorian era. Although basic bookbinding techniques will be the focus of this session, Ms. Byers will also touch upon some of the alternative, more complex techniques typically utilized by professional bookbinders.
The cost of this workshop is $50 and includes all tools, materials and refreshments. Registration in advance is required for all participants through our website at www.rossbayvilla.org.
